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
54683006 957489830 57093305
52 6950
52 6950
332 18 78259634 24134127
All about undefined
Interested in learning more?
52 6950
332 18 78259634 24134127
See more
236881721 04
879 46 4260206246
See more
668147786 2378
67060059443 54 64081
See more